KKR vs SRH preview: IPL history's two most expensive players in spotlight as Shreyas Iyer makes his comeback

IPL 2024, KKR vs SRH: The last time the two teams played at Eden Gardens, it turned out to be a high-scoring game where the visitors won by a comfortable margin.

The third game of the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2024 is set to be a high-voltage encounter. Firstly, IPL history’s most expensive players – Kolkata Knight Riders’ (KKR) Mitchell Starc and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) skipper Pat Cummins – will be in the spotlight. The two franchises have not had a good run in the past couple of players but with Shreyas Iyer coming back and Gautam Gambhir at the helm of things, KKR look dangerous with their new recruits. Also, SRH now look like the side that will be the dark horse in this season. 
 

Iyer on the eve of KKR’s campaign opener confirmed that he is fit and ready to go. He was the missing piece in the puzzle for KKR in the previous season. Starc returning after a long hiatus is a massive boost and if he gets the new ball talking, SRH may end up playing the catch-up game against the hosts. Big hitters Rinku Singh and Andre Russell provide the cushion KKR need to follow a strong top order. Their spin trio of Sunil Narine, Varun Chakravarthy is bound to pose a few tough questions to SRH batters.
 

KKR’s last-minute addition

As Jason Roy pulled out of IPL 2024, KKR made a last-minute change by bringing in England’s wicketkeeper-batter Phil Salt. The change may be a blessing in disguise for KKR as Rahmanullah Gurbaz has not been in the best of forms of late. Salt is capable of getting the side off to blazing starts and it won’t be a surprise if he walks into the playing XI. 

SRH face the problem of plenty 

It may be a toss-up between Mayank Agarwal and Abhishek Sharma for the opening spot alongside Travis Head. As SRH have Aiden Markram and Heinrich Klaasen in their ranks, Cummins will be the only overseas bowlers which means they may have to leave out all-rounder Marco Jansen. The only way they can include Jansen is by dropping former skipper Markam. It will be interesting to see the team combination and impact player the SRH think tank opts for against KKR.

Head-to-head

KKR and SRH have played 25 games against each other. KKR have won 16 of these games. The last time SRH played at Eden Gardens, Harry Brook's maiden IPL century and Markram's half-century helped the visitors post 228/4 and win the match by 23 runs despite fifties from Nitish Rana and Shardul Thakur.
